Hello, I want to produce the same figures. For example I have figure(1),figure(2). figure(1) with some points that are plotted in it and figure(2) is an empty screen. I want to copy figure(1) in figure(2).How can I do this with commands in matlab? please help me thanks a lot

plot(peaks)
a1 = gca
f2 = figure
a2 = copyobj(a1,f2)

As the help text explains, copyobj duplicates objects to a new parent. So it does not copy the figure, but the objects the figure contains. The example contained in these docs should be descriptive enough already.
